Scope:
The IEEE Transactions on Sustainable Energy is a journal aimed at disseminating results of research on sustainable energy systems that can be integrated into the power transmission and/or distribution grid. The journal publishes original research on design, implementation, grid-integration and control of sustainable energy technologies and systems. The Transactions also welcomes manuscripts on design, implementation and evaluation of power systems that are affected by sustainable energy systems and devices.

Examples of topics out-of-scope:
- Microgrid design, optimization, operation and control – not involving renewable energy generation characteristics
- Virtual power plant design, optimization, control not involving renewable energy plants
- Protection of renewable generation – except involving fault ride through
- Design, optimization and control of power converters without consideration of network
- Theory and principle of generation of power from stand-alone power generation, conversion or storage technologies without involving electric power network
- Renewable energy development and feasibility study project not involving new modeling and methodology of design optimization
- Sharing operating experience of sustainable and other community energy development projects without technical rigor and methodology
- Dynamics and condition monitoring of wave/wind/tidal turbine mechanical components
- Resource (wind, irradiance, tide, ocean current, etc.) assessment except forecasting for use in power grid operations.
Peer Review
The articles in this journal are peer reviewed in accordance with the requirements set forth in the IEEE Publication Services and Products Board Operations Manual (https://pspb.ieee.org/images/files/files/opsmanual.pdf). Each published article was reviewed by a minimum of two independent reviewers using a single-blind peer review process, where the identities of the reviewers are not known to the authors, but the reviewers know the identities of the authors. Articles will be screened for plagiarism before acceptance.
Open Access
This publication is a hybrid journal, allowing either Traditional manuscript submission or Open Access (author-pays OA) manuscript submission.
The OA option, if selected, enables unrestricted public access to the article via IEEE Xplore. The OA option will be offered to the author at the time the manuscript is submitted. If selected, the OA discounted fee of $2,345 be paid before the article is published in the journal. If you have unusual circumstances about this, please contact the Editor-in-Chief. Any other applicable charges (such as the over-length page charge and/or charge for the use of color in the print format) will be billed separately once the manuscript formatting is complete but prior to the publication.
The traditional option, if selected, enables access to all qualified subscribers and purchasers via IEEE Xplore. No OA payment is required.
